Go to your save data folder ( Steam\userdata\[User ID]\240460\remote ). Locate and delete only the file named . Launch the game again
Go to your Steam installation folder (usually C:\Program Files (x86)\Steam\userdata\[Your Steam ID]\240460 ) and delete the entire 240460 folder. Note: 240460 is the unique App ID for WWE 2K15.
